Screen Shot 2018-10-23 at 11.16.21 AM.pngTelemundo has posted a highly disturbing video of a white woman screaming profanities at a Spanish-speaking family and demanding to see their passports.  The offensive tirade captures our age of rage in this country. The video was taken by the Guatemalan woman who appears the target of the enraged diatribe at Andy’s restaurant in Lovettsville, Virginia.  The incident is painfully reminiscent of the video of New York attorney Aaron Schlossberg that we discussed earlier in the year.

In the video, the woman demands to see the passport of the mother dining with her 7-year-old child and other members of her family.

She screams “Go back to your fucking country . . . You do not fucking come over here and freeload on America.”  The scene continues outside where she seems to say that she does not want to see the United States becomes “Sweden.”  President Donald Trump has often raises Sweden as an example of the dangers of undocumented immigrants. The woman screams how  “I’m tired of this shit. … You [censored] freeload on us!”

The video is chilling and highly disturbing.  Indeed, the most unAmerican display in the video was not the family trying to have lunch with a young child but the woman demanding passports simply due to their conversation in Spanish.

The restaurant has said that the woman will not be allowed to return, but the police arrived after the woman had left the scene with her male companion.
